Understanding Flat Roofing Systems in Belmont

Flat roofs, despite their name, are not entirely flat; they are designed with a slight slope to allow for water drainage. In a region like Belmont, where precipitation can be significant, proper drainage is key to preventing water pooling, which can lead to leaks and structural damage. The materials used in flat roofing are distinct from those used in pitched roofs, requiring specialized installation and maintenance techniques. Local roofing professionals in Belmont are well-versed in the unique challenges and requirements of these roofing systems.

Common Flat Roofing Materials

Several types of flat roofing materials are popular among contractors serving Belmont and surrounding communities like Waltham and Arlington. Each offers different benefits and requires specific installation methods. Understanding these options can help property owners make informed decisions when considering new installations or repairs:

  • Asphalt Built-Up Roofing (BUR): A traditional and cost-effective option, BUR consists of multiple layers of asphalt and reinforcing materials, topped with gravel or a reflective coating.
  • Modified Bitumen Roofing: Similar to BUR but with added polymers for increased flexibility and durability, modified bitumen is applied in rolls and can be heat-welded, cold-applied, or self-adhered.
  • Single-Ply Membranes: These are large, flexible sheets designed to be laid in a single layer. Common types include EPDM (ethylene propylene diene monomer), TPO (thermoplastic polyolefin), and PVC (polyvinyl chloride). They are often favored for their durability and ease of installation.
  • Liquid-Applied Membranes: These are applied in a liquid form and cure to create a seamless, waterproof barrier, ideal for complex roof shapes or areas prone to leaks.

How Flat Roofing Services are Performed by Local Professionals

When a homeowner or business owner in Belmont requires flat roofing services, whether for a new installation or repairs, local roofing contractors follow a systematic approach. This ensures a thorough and effective solution tailored to the specific building and its environment. The process typically involves:

  • Initial Inspection and Assessment: Experienced roofers will begin by conducting a comprehensive inspection of the existing flat roof. This includes identifying any signs of damage, such as cracks, blisters, punctures, or areas of ponding water. They will also assess the overall condition of the underlying structure.
  • Preparation and Repair: Before any new materials are applied, the roof surface must be clean and dry. Any damaged sections of the existing roof will be repaired or removed. This might involve patching, reinforcing, or addressing any underlying decking issues.
  • Material Installation: The chosen flat roofing material is then installed according to the manufacturer’s specifications and industry best practices. This might involve rolling out membranes, applying adhesives, or heat-welding seams. Strict attention is paid to creating a watertight seal, especially around penetrations like vents and drainage systems.
  • Flashing and Detailing: Proper flashing around parapet walls, chimneys, and edges is crucial for preventing water intrusion. Professionals meticulously install and seal these areas to ensure complete protection.
  • Final Inspection and Cleanup: Once the installation or repair is complete, a final inspection is performed to ensure that all work has been done to the highest standard. The job site is then thoroughly cleaned of all debris.

Frequently Asked Questions about Flat Roofing in Belmont

What are the most common flat roofing issues in Belmont due to the local climate?

In Belmont, MA, the most common flat roofing issues are often related to the region’s diverse weather. Heavy snowfall can lead to excessive weight on the roof and potential ice dams that force water under seals. Frequent rain can cause ponding if drainage systems are inadequate or blocked, leading to leaks and material degradation. Freeze-thaw cycles can also cause expansion and contraction of roofing materials, creating cracks and compromising seams over time. These conditions necessitate regular inspections and prompt repairs to prevent water infiltration and structural damage.

How often should I have my flat roof inspected in Belmont?

It is generally recommended to have your flat roof inspected at least twice a year in Belmont, with additional inspections after severe weather events. An inspection in the spring can help identify any damage caused by winter weather, such as ice dams or snow load stress. An inspection in the fall can prepare the roof for the upcoming winter by clearing debris from drains and identifying any potential vulnerabilities.

Are there specific flat roofing materials that are better suited for Belmont’s weather conditions?

While many flat roofing materials can perform well in Belmont, certain options offer enhanced durability against regional weather. Single-ply membranes like TPO and EPDM are known for their flexibility and resistance to temperature fluctuations and ponding water. Modified bitumen with robust weather-resistant top layers is also a good choice. For commercial buildings, reflective coatings can help mitigate heat absorption in the summer and offer an extra layer of protection. With 5,922 annual heating degree days, Belmont is in a climate where ice dams are a real seasonal hazard — attic heat escapes through the roof deck, melts snow, and the meltwater refreezes at the cold eaves, backing up under shingles and causing interior moisture damage. Proper attic insulation, air sealing, and ice-and-water shield at the eaves are the primary defenses. Source: Open-Meteo ERA5 Climate Reanalysis, 2014–2023 average.

Will homeowners insurance cover Flat Roofing in Belmont?

Insurance typically covers sudden storm damage — hail, wind, and falling trees — but not gradual wear or pre-existing deterioration. Given Belmont's average of 3.1 significant hail events per year, storm-damage claims are relatively common in this area. Document all damage with photos immediately after a storm and contact your insurer before any repair work begins.
